FedEx suspends all pickups for shipments to Israel and Iraq

FedEx said on Friday all pickups for shipments destined to Israel and Iraq will be suspended.

Israel-Iran conflict: B-2 bombers, bunker-busters; what to know about US' most advanced weapons

The US Air Force's B-2 Spirit stealth bomber represents one of America's most advanced strategic weapons platforms, capable of entering sophisticated air defences and delivering precision strikes against hardened targets such as Iran's buried network of nuclear research facilities. The US military is ready to carry out any decision that President Donald Trump may make on Iran, Defence Secretary Pete Hegseth said on Wednesday, adding that Tehran should have heeded the President's calls for it to make a deal on its nuclear programme prior to the start of Israel's strikes on Friday. Iranian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ei rejected Trump's demand for unconditional surrender on Wednesday, and the US President said his patience had run out, though he gave no clue as to what his next step would be. B-2 Spirit specifications The US B-2 costs about $2.1 billion each, making it the most expensive military aircraft ever built. Made by Northrop Grumman the bomber with its cutting-edge stealth technology, began its production run in the late 1980s but was curbed by the fall of the Soviet Union. Only 21 were made after the Pentagon's planned acquisition programme was truncated. The bomber's range of over 6,000 nautical miles without refueling enables global strike capabilities from continental US bases. With aerial refueling, the B-2 can reach virtually any target worldwide, as demonstrated in missions from Missouri to Afghanistan and Libya. Its payload capacity of more than 40,000 pounds allows the aircraft to carry a diverse array of conventional and nuclear weapons. The bomber's internal weapons bays are specifically designed to maintain stealth characteristics while accommodating large ordnance loads which could include two GBU-57A/B MOP (Massive Ordnance Penetrator), a 30,000-pound precision-guided "bunker buster" bomb. The two-pilot crew configuration reduces personnel requirements while maintaining operational effectiveness through advanced automation systems. The B-2's stealth technology incorporates radar-absorbing materials and angular design features that minimise detection by enemy air defence systems. Its radar cross-section is reportedly comparable to that of a small bird, making it nearly invisible to conventional radar. Massive Ordnance Penetrator (MOP) The 30,000-pound MOP represents the largest conventional bomb in the U.S. arsenal, specifically engineered to defeat hardened underground bunkers. Its massive size requires the B-2 to carry only one or two MOPs per mission, but provides unmatched bunker-penetration capability. The weapon's 20.5-foot length and GPS-guided precision targeting system enable accurate strikes against specific underground facilities. Its penetration capability of over 200 feet through hardened concrete makes it effective against the world's most protected underground installations. Conventional payloads Joint Direct Attack Munitions (JDAM) provide the B-2 with precision conventional strike capability against fixed targets. These GPS-guided weapons can be deployed in large numbers, with the bomber capable of simultaneously engaging multiple targets with high accuracy. Joint Standoff Weapons (JSOW) extend the aircraft's engagement range while maintaining stealth characteristics during approach. These glide bombs allow the B-2 to strike targets from outside heavily defended airspace perimeters. Joint Air-to-Surface Standoff Missiles (JASSM) offer long-range precision strike capability with their own stealth features. The extended-range JASSM-ER variant provides strike options against targets over 500 miles (805 km) away. Nuclear payload capabilities The B-2 Spirit serves as a key component of America's nuclear triad, capable of delivering strategic nuclear weapons with stealth and precision. The aircraft can carry up to 16 B83 nuclear bombs.

GCC tourism spending projected to hit $223.7 bn by 2034

The Statistical Centre for the Cooperation Council for the Arab Countries of the Gulf (GCC-Stat) has released data showing visitor spending in GCC countries is expected to reach $223.7 billion by 2034. The projections indicate that incoming visitor spending will contribute 13.4 percent to total exports by 2034, according to a statement by the Emirates News Agency (WAM), which cited the Centre's latest analysis. GCC visitor spending jumps 28.9% since 2019 to reach $135.5 billion GCC countries have recorded progress across multiple tourism indicators, with international visitor spending reaching $135.5 billion in 2023. This figure represents a 28.9 percent increase compared to spending recorded in 2019. The region has secured the top position in the Middle East and North Africa's 2024 Safety and Security Index. All GCC member states scored above the regional average of 5.86 points on the index, which operates on a scale from 1 to 7 points. GCC countries have also achieved recognition for passport strength, with all six nations ranking among the top performers in the Arab region for passport power. The Centre's data highlights the tourism sector's growing contribution to the GCC economy, with visitor spending showing recovery and growth following the 2019 baseline period.

Bahrain Marina appoints CBRE Bahrain to manage retail sector and develop leasing strategy

Manama: Bahrain Marina Development Company, the master developer of the prestigious Bahrain Marina project located along the eastern waterfront of the capital, Manama, has announced the appointment of the leading global commercial real estate services and investment firm CBRE Bahrain to manage and operate the project's retail units. CBRE Bahrain will also be responsible for developing a comprehensive leasing strategy, encompassing the determination of the optimal brand mix, commercial area planning, and occupancy strategies. This appointment reflects Bahrain Marina's commitment to attracting leading international partners to deliver a high-end shopping and entertainment experience, further enhancing the project's appeal as an integrated urban destination that draws visitors from Bahrain and across the region. On this occasion, Bahrain Marina Development affirmed in a press statement that the appointment of CBRE Bahrain marks a pivotal step toward enhancing the commercial value of the Bahrain Marina project's components and establishing a strong foundation for an exceptional shopping experience at the national level. The company noted that CBRE's global expertise will contribute to attracting prestigious retail brands and delivering a unique retail environment that meets the aspirations of both visitors and residents alike. This will be achieved through professional operational management and meticulous strategic planning that ensures sustainable operations and a diverse brand mix. For its part, CBRE Bahrain stated that it is delighted to partner with Bahrain Marina on this landmark project, which represents a significant milestone in Bahrain's real estate development landscape. Leveraging global expertise, CBRE Bahrain will deliver an integrated operational experience designed to enhance the development's overall appeal. As the appointed Property Management firm for the retail component, CBRE Bahrain is committed to supporting Bahrain Marina through a strategic and structured approach to managing this key asset. This partnership aims to elevate the destination's profile, attracting leading international and regional brands that will enrich the commercial offering and reflect the project's unique identity. Under the agreement, CBRE Bahrain will oversee the daily operations of the commercial facilities and will develop an innovative leasing plan, identifying tenant profiles and creating a commercial distribution map, ensuring a balanced mix of retail, hospitality, and complementary services. The Bahrain Marina project spans more than 250,000 square meters and features 128 retail units distributed among a collection of upscale shops, international restaurants, and renowned cafés. It also includes luxurious residential facilities, a state-of-the-art marina, a beach club, and a five-star hotel. Bahrain Marina is positioned as one of the most prominent new waterfront destinations, redefining the shopping, tourism, and entertainment scene in the heart of Manama.
